This classic classroom paste is a staple for arts and crafts, offering a safe and effective adhesive for children’s projects. Made from basic pantry staples like flour, sugar, and water, it creates a smooth, consistent texture ideal for bonding paper, cardboard, and fabric. The addition of powdered alum helps preserve the paste, preventing spoilage during storage, while a hint of cinnamon oil adds a pleasant scent and further acts as a natural preservative. This homemade alternative to commercial glues is cost-effective, easy to prepare, and perfect for busy school days or weekend craft sessions. It spreads easily, dries clear, and holds firmly, making it an essential tool for any creative workspace. Store it in a sealed jar to keep it fresh for weeks.

Directions
-
Combine 1 cup of non-self-rising wheat flour and 1 cup of sugar in a large, heavy-bottomed pot.
-
Slowly stir in 4 cups of cold water, mixing thoroughly to form a smooth, lump-free paste.
-
Gradually pour in 4 cups of boiling water while stirring vigorously to prevent clumping.
-
Place the pot over medium heat and bring the mixture to a boil, stirring constantly.
-
Continue cooking and stirring until the mixture thickens and becomes clear and glossy.
-
Remove the pot from the heat source.
-
Stir in 1 tablespoon of powdered alum until fully dissolved and incorporated.
-
If the paste will not be used immediately, add 1/2 teaspoon of oil of cinnamon for preservation and scent.
-
Allow the paste to cool slightly before transferring it to a clean, tightly capped jar for storage.
-
Use as an all-purpose adhesive for children's crafts or papier-mâché projects.
-
If the paste thickens over time, thin it with a small amount of hot water before use.
